
Worked on improving DNS configuration reliability for containerized deployments in the pi-hole/docker-pi-hole repository by addressing a bug related to case sensitivity in the DNS listening mode setting. Implemented a fix to ensure the FTLCONF_dns_listeningMode variable is handled with correct casing, reducing the risk of misconfiguration in Docker bridge networks. Updated related documentation in Markdown to align setup instructions with the code, enhancing clarity for users.
